Chief of Party
at ADRA, Nepal
Project Activity: USAID/ Nepal Adolescent Reproductive Health
Location: Kathmandu, Nepal
Job Description
Adventist Development and Relief Agency (ADRA) is a global humanitarian agency providing relief and development assistance to individuals in 130 countries regardless of their ethnicity, political affiliation, gender, or religious association. ADRA seeks an experienced Chief of Party (COP) to lead and manage the anticipated USAID/ Nepal Adolescent Reproductive Health activity that will expand the demand, supply, and use of quality, adolescent-responsive reproductive health services and products through a systems strengthening approach. The ideal candidate will be a seasoned Project Director and/or Chief of Party with experience working on family planning or reproductive health issues in Nepal or the region.
